Default Tire shine

I just tried this product from Armor All and it works great!! It is Extreme Tire shine gel.

http://www.armorall.com/products/view_product.php?product_id=24&main_group=3&catego ry_index=tire



It comes with a sponge applicator that lets you put the product precisely where you want it. The spray on tire shines always seemed to miss spots, you had to clean your wheels afterwards, and it can stain your driveway.

I have had this product on my tires for two weeks now, and it still looks great!! It is also not too shiny, just a nice black finish.

Default Re: Tire shine

I use meguires
It doesnt get dusty and last a long time,only power washing and beach sand /mud get it worn off.
I only do it every few months as its a waste to apply if your going to the beach or off roading within a week or two of putting it on.
You get about 3 or 4 aplications per can.

It also has a adjustable nossle for big tires
